python - 如何找到哪个pip包拥有一个文件?

标签 python pip

我有一个文件,我怀疑它是由 pip 安装的。 我如何才能找到哪个包安装了该文件?

换句话说,我正在寻找类似于 pacman -Qo filenamedpkg -S filename 的命令,但用于 pip .它存在吗?或者我应该使用 pipgrep 的某种组合吗? 在那种情况下,我不知道如何列出所有已安装的文件。

最佳答案

你可以试试

pip list | tail -n +3 | cut -d" " -f1 | xargs pip show -f | grep "filename"

然后搜索结果以查找该文件。

关于python - 如何找到哪个pip包拥有一个文件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33483818/

相关文章:

python - Optparse 和 sys.argv - Python

python - 打开一个没有焦点的 pyglet 窗口

python - 将字母添加到 Pandas 列中的数字

python-3.x - 非 AVX 系统上的 Tensorflow 2.2.0 支持

python - 如何找到通过 egg-link 安装的 python 包的位置?

python - Windows 10 pip 安装 'Failed Connection'

Python/Numpy - 从子集中获取主数组的索引

python - 雷有奇怪的耗时

windows - 如何在 Windows 上安装 scikits.audiolab 0.11.0

python - 使用 anaconda navigator 在 Windows 上导入 TensorFlow 时出错